Mission: Canine partners of the rockies (capr) enables coloradans with disabilities to lead more independent and gratifying lives partnering them with highly skilled assistance dogs that also provide unconditional love and tail- wagging enthusiasm.
Programs: As of december 31 2014, canine partners of the rockies had 15 active service partnerships. We received over 70 applications for assitance dogs. We had 13 dogs in training; two of which were in advanced training with professional trainers. We placed one facility service dog with a professional who works with children on the austism spectrum. We supported and remedially trained post one year partnerships. We arranged speaking and demonstration engagements to educate the public about the role of assitance dogs in the lives of people with disabilities. These engagements reached close to 2,500 people of all ages from kindergarteners to seniors.
